Electronic payments, from 2023 fines to those who do not accept them
It will range from a minimum of 30 euros, to which 4% of the value of the denied transaction must be added

Sanctions for traders and professionals (doctors, lawyers, taxi drivers, etc.) who refuse payments of any amount with debit, credit and prepaid cards.
The Recovery Decree establishes it, which establishes a minimum penalty of 30 euros, increased by 4% of the value of the transaction.
Although the obligation to accept these payments had already been established by the Monti government, until now sanctions had not yet been introduced in case of non-compliance with the rule.
It seems that the consumer himself will have to report the merchant who refuses the use of the POS; then an inspection by the police will be needed, who will be able to impose the sanction.
The provision will enter into force from January 1, 2023 ( a first version of the amendment had assumed January 2022).
The measure represents a further tightening by the government on the use of cash and an incentive to increase the use of traceable payment instruments, in order to favor the emergence of the underground economy and stimulate technological development by modernizing society and the economy.
It is added to the reduction of the limit on cash payments to one thousand euros , effective from January 1st.
